Synonyms in Detail: maiden and virgin Usage & Differences

What context can I use each word in?

Learn when and how to use these words with these examples!

maiden

Example

The maiden voyage of the ship was a success. [maiden: adjective]

Example

She was a fair maiden with long golden hair. [maiden: noun]

virgin

Example

She was a virgin until she got married. [virgin: noun]

Example

The virgin snow was undisturbed by footprints. [virgin: adjective]

Good things to know

Which word is more common?

Virgin is more commonly used than maiden in everyday language, particularly in the context of sexual history. Maiden is less common and has a more formal and literary tone.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between maiden and virgin?

Both maiden and virgin are more formal than casual in tone, but maiden has a more old-fashioned and literary connotation, while virgin has a more scientific and technical connotation.
